To a military family..Yellow means separationby okiesisiComment: Hello okiesisi Sorry I missed you on my little attempt to comment on all of the shots for this challenge. As for the shot. I fully understand the separation that you are portraying in this shot. I was in the military for seveal years and can fully understand the pain and anguish that the military spouse feel when ther loved ones are away.I think your shot may have been hurt a little bit in score for two reasons one Like you stated in your PM just not real exiting. Two you probably lost a little bit from the foreign voters. I doubt that they would have any idea what a yellow ribbon stands for. This was very wel shor none the less. Good color and sharpness. However due to the unexiting objects in the shot I feel you might have done a bit better playing around with gaussian blur, or a pin hole lens. This would have enhanced the shot a bit disguising the mundane aspects, and perhaps enhancing the technical aspects of the shot. I ended up giving this a 4. Solely on the fact that it lacked excitement or interest. On the bright side however as I stated earlier however this was very well shot. |
